Dr.’s here at The Foot Institute – Grande Prairie concentrate on the medical and surgical therapy of the foot and ankle. Foot Institute Podiatrists devote around a decade in higher education, the first four years in undergraduate studies to secure a Bachelors Degree, and the following 4 years in Medical School to receive a Podiatric Medical Degree. Podiatric Medical School corresponds to typical medical school and in fact several podiatry programmes are located inside these academic institutions. After obtaining a Podiatric Medial Degree, Podiatrists at the Foot Institute finish a hospital "internship" or post degree residency for another one to three years.
At the fulfillment of the internship or residency, our Foot doctors have acquired considerable medical training with an importance on problems involving the ankles and feet. Our Doctors are trained to manage conditions ranging from general conditions for instance, ingrown and fungal toenails, to those which are more intricate including clubfoot, bunions, or reconstructive surgery of the foot. Our physicians have substantial surgical education which provide them the expertise required to execute surgical treatment on those problems that are best managed through surgical treatment.
Doctors at the Foot Institute furthermore have a thorough practical knowledge and understanding of biomechanics, which is the study of the forces which the legs and feet endure as we walk, run or perform other activities. Having knowledge of biomechanics and gait peculiarities allows a Foot doctor to design shoes and orthotics which can give pain relief and minimize the risk of many problems which the feet normally encounter.
